Aframomum melegueta Extract

Also known as: grains of paradise, ColorBurn®, 6-paradol, African cardamom

C
Evidence

Aframomum melegueta is a West African spice containing 6-paradol and related pungent compounds that may modestly support thermogenesis and metabolic rate. Evidence is preliminary and limited to animal studies and small human trials.

Evidence notes

Evidence is limited to animal studies and a small number of preliminary human trials. 6-Paradol shows mechanistic promise via thermogenic pathways but lacks robust RCT data in humans. No large-scale clinical trials have established clear efficacy for weight management.

Grade C: Mostly observational or small trials; mechanism is plausible but unproven at scale.
